Output 751ec6684fe17496ca368f76cdf367dc545174c35bb225ae81d955abc13dca71:3
- value
- 21690000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c14cf0ea4ab48123aeae815844ba259e17ce869 OP_EQUAL
- address
- 37AhPsjaqH3zvPNrsgyUJPPJj3tTY6PsWp
- transaction
- 751ec6684fe17496ca368f76cdf367dc545174c35bb225ae81d955abc13dca71
- spent
- true